Output c66e5072c68655c2022bb937581f9630542014b088ad8f8d91d8d81848422a48:32
- value
- 40818059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da45ad4497c457161a06a33ae06586441e4f08b3 OP_EQUAL
- address
- 3Mb8hbPKp5cu7PqVVsgPgs3q8sMQDEU3VP
- transaction
- c66e5072c68655c2022bb937581f9630542014b088ad8f8d91d8d81848422a48
- confirmations
- 154344
- spent
- true